制作一个编程作业保险箱可以通过以下步骤进行:
材料准备
一个废纸壳或纸板箱
电机
线缆
电池
回形针
热缩管
热熔胶
橡皮筋
竹签
剪刀
刻刀
显示器(如LCD)
Arduino板
制作保险箱结构
将废纸壳或纸板箱粘合成一个封闭的小盒子,并在侧面切开一个小门,注意门的最后一条边是连在箱子里不用切掉的。
利用竹签和橡皮筋制作一个门闩,并在保险箱门背后用三根竹签粘出一个横放和竖放“三”字,把门闩卡在里面。
用回形针拧成图片中的形状,粘在门闩上,通过回形针将门闩卡在两个“三”之间,热缩管套在回形针末端,用打火机烤一下让热缩管紧紧粘在回形针铁丝上。
用热熔胶将马达粘在门后,用橡皮筋连接马达转轴和热缩管。
用电烙铁将马达正负极引线焊接在图钉上,将图钉从里到外插在DIY保险箱的“门”上,注意图钉间距要刚好能让方块电池正负极触头同时接触。
在门外用热熔胶粘一个废瓶盖,作为保险箱柜门的把手。
编程实现
编写程序控制电机转动,实现保险箱门的锁定和解锁。可以使用Arduino板进行编程,通过连接马达的正负极和电池,控制马达的正向或反向旋转,从而导致门闩的合上或打开。
可以设置进阶挑战,如在“运转度数”中设置数值,使按钮再次被按压的同时,顺时针或逆时针旋转一定度数,才可以解锁保险箱的门,实现更精准的控制。
测试与调试
连接电池和马达,按下按钮测试门是否能够正常锁定和解锁。
如果需要更精准的控制,可以调整“运转度数”的数值,观察门的开合情况。
通过以上步骤,你就可以制作一个简单的编程作业保险箱。这个保险箱不仅可以用来存放贵重物品,还可以通过编程实现更高级的功能,如设置解锁密码等。希望这个指南对你有所帮助!